It depends on whether or not you're willing to redesign the deck. Zur works because there are innumerable enchantments in Esper for three or less mana that can and do win games. I think it's worth it to cut some of the expensive enchantments that don't do much to make room for a more synergistic, reliable deck. It's ultimately your call, though.
Fair enough. You may want to look into using Cloud Key , Semblance Anvil , and Mana Matrix , then. You could also use Zur as a normal creature since he's still useful.
Mesa Enchantress , Argothian Enchantress , and Verduran Enchantress are strong draw engines. You could also include Open the Vaults and Replenish .
